Output 5ffad4ec49bbdbf30e35a0660b65c3f8aa0fa078d2425016b54aec3156135db7:6

value
19521481
script pubkey
OP_0 OP_PUSHBYTES_20 113eec77d4edd281292797335506831edc0328f6
address
bc1qzylwca75ahfgz2f8jue42p5rrmwqx28kltww8s
transaction
5ffad4ec49bbdbf30e35a0660b65c3f8aa0fa078d2425016b54aec3156135db7
confirmations
119837
spent
true